A fantastic spacious second floor apartment with two double bedrooms situated with good access to Leeds and Wakefield and close to the M1 motorway. Virtual tour available. EPC rating C80.

A deceptively spacious and well proportioned top floor two bedroom apartment, occupying a prime position within a well regarded modern development and benefiting from an en suite to the principal bedroom and allocated parking.

The property is presented in ready to move into condition and benefits from gas fired central heating and sealed unit double glazed windows. Access is gained via a secure communal entrance hallway with intercom system, leading to a private entrance hall with a useful built in storage cupboard. A generously sized living room enjoys an outlook to the front of the development, with an archway opening through to a well appointed dining kitchen fitted with a range of quality units and integrated appliances, complemented by a dedicated dining area. The principal bedroom overlooks the front and benefits from a modern en suite shower room, whilst the second double bedroom is also front facing and has easy access to the contemporary house bathroom. Externally, the property is set within well maintained, communal gardens and includes an allocated parking space.

The development is conveniently located within easy reach of a range of local shops, schools and recreational facilities, with a broader selection of amenities available within Wakefield city centre, which offers a mainline railway station and excellent access to the national motorway network.
